If you continue browsing the site, you agree to the use of cookies on this website. Filter by location to see database architect salaries in your area. First, we will see 3tier architecture, which is very important. An enterprise information system data architecture guide. Includes descriptions of the database structure, data types, and the constraints on the database. Architectures for dbmss have followed trends similar to those for general computer system architectures.
Understanding how the database works and how it differs from a relational database will save you a lot of time when setting up and operating datastax. Database systems can be centralized, or clientserver, where one server machine executes work on behalf of multiple client machines. The most recent and popular model of database design is the relational database model. Three schema architecture consisting of 1 external view, 2 conceptual level, 3 internal level. Given the exploding data problem, all but three of the above mentioned analytical database startups deploy their dbms on a sharednothing architecture a. Stack overflow architecture update now at 95 million page views a month update. Each of these data architectural patterns illustrates a common data operation and how it is implemented in a system.
Mar 18, 2020 examples of database mysql, sql server, and oracle database are some common dbs. Database system architecture sl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. Jan, 2020 important information for understanding how the datastax enterprise database works. Required data in a computer that manages a database. Database architecture database administrators stack exchange. Generally such a setup is used for local application development, where programmers communicate directly with the database for quick response. Scribd is the worlds largest social reading and publishing site. Database architect jobs in india 1016 database architect. Common web application architectures microsoft docs. This paper is a technical evaluation of two different database architectures. Apr 08, 2020 how much does a database architect make. Architecture in brief essential information for understanding and using datastax enterprise internode communications gossip datastax enterprise 5.
Jan 08, 2015 the old models of data architecture arent enough for todays datadriven business demands. The portion of the real world relevant to the database is sometimes referred to as the universe of discourse or as the database miniworld. The database architecture is the set of specifications, rules, and processes that dictate how data is stored in a database and how data is accessed by components of a system. Before moving on to the next lesson, click the link below to read more about database threeschema architecture. A userfriendly qt application for managing database schemas. Database system concepts and architecture schemas versus instances.
Pdf database architecture for the internet of things. Understanding dbms architecture a database management system is not always directly available for users and applications to access and store data in it. Chapter 2, data blocks, extents, and segments chapter 3, tablespaces, datafiles, and control files chapter 4, transaction management. Codd who identifies features of a good relational database as following. Dbms architecture 1tier, 2tier and 3tier studytonight.
In relational database management systems rdbmss, many of which started as centralized systems, the system components that were first moved to the client side were the user interface and application. Work onsite only at the dnr central office in downtown madison, wi to comple. The relational model draws greatly on the work of e. Important information for understanding how the datastax enterprise database works architecture in brief. Architecture of a database system presents an architectural discussion of dbms design principles, including process models, parallel architecture, storage system design, transaction system implementation, query. The threelevel architecture forms the basis of modern database architectures. There are 18 terabytes of data of mission critical data that needs to be available 24 hrs a day. This is an integral part of numerous business operations, because large enterprises, and even small businesses, often depend on databases to store and manage large volumes of data. The index server processes incoming sql or mdx statements in the context of authenticated sessions and transactions. Architecture of a database system berkeley university of.
In this work an architectural model for cloud database management system has been developed. In ntier, n refers to a number of tiers or layers are being used like 2tier, 3tier or 4tier, etc. In other words, the technical nittygrrity of your software application. Some of the board models of database architecture are as follows. Acts as database subject matter expert and casts the vision for our database architecture. This model was developed to overcome the problems of complexity and inflexibility of the earlier two models in handling databases with manytomany relationships between entities. Centralized and clientserver architectures for dbmss. Here are the 8 essential components to building a modern data. Database samples such as access and sql server called database management systems dbms. It includes data types, relationships, and naming conventions. Data architecture is a set of rules, policies, standards and models that govern and define the type of data collected and how it is used, stored, managed and integrated within an organization and its database systems.
Database architecture wingenious database architecture 3 introduction. It clearly indicates the logical and physical intricacies of the software application that is used store your data. You can create, delete, and modify schemas as well as individual database tables. Here are the 8 essential components to building a modern data architecture. Includes a biographical database of british architects. The catalogue indexes articles from about 300 architecture journals from around the world, as well as books, drawings, photographs, manuscripts, audiovisual and other material in the british architectural library. Net applications are deployed as single units corresponding to an executable or a single web application running within a single iis. Stay up to date on business requirements and objectives, particularly as these relate to database architecture issues. Threelevel architecture view 1 view 2 view n user 1 user 2 user n conceptual schema internal schema database external level conceptual level internal level physical data organization objective. Firstly, it is discussed how a conceptual 1 scheme can be transferred into a database environment and which typical database models can be used for this task. In this article if you think good architecture is expensive, try bad architecture.
Concepts of database architecture oceanize geeks medium. Visit payscale to research database architect salaries by city, experience, skill, employer and more. Database access is stateless and all updates to the actual database via the web server are performed optimistically. A multitenant application architecture can adopt one of three database architectures. A 3tier architecture separates its tiers from each other based on the complexity of the users and how they use the data present in the database. What make database unique is the fact that databases are design to retrieve data quickly. Understanding how the database works and how it differs from a relational database will save you a lot of time when setting up and operating datastax enterprise in a production environment. Important information for understanding how the datastax enterprise database works.
The database approach uses a common data model for the entire database and the user program is not concerned with the placement of a particular data element. When dbas talk about most things related to memory, they are talking about the sga. Salary estimates are based on 1,800 salaries submitted anonymously to glassdoor by database architect. It provides a formal approach to creating and managing the flow of data and how it is processed across an organizations it. The difference of databasecentric systems from the software developed by the procedural or objectoriented paradigm is the strict layering of the developed software. Three schema architecture the next lesson introduces a special class of tools often used in database design. A corporation has decided to move its production data off the os 390 platform to a windows platform running the windows data center operating system. Schema architecture1user view, 2 logical, 3 physical. Database systems can also be designed to exploit parallel computer architectures. Stack overflow is a much loved programmer question and answer site written by. Apply to software architect, senior database developer, sql developer and more.
Earlier architectures used mainframe computers to provide the main processing for all system functions, including user application programs and user interface programs, as well. Since the design process is complicated, especially for large databases, database. Architecture of a database system is an invaluable reference for database researchers and practitioners and for those in other areas of computing interested in the systems design techniques for scalability and reliability that originated in dbms research and development. A database with a physical configuration indexes, isam files, disk placement, clustering, etc is placed at the bottom of this layered architecture. Part ii describes the basic structural architecture of the oracle database, including physical and logical storage structures. The database functionality is virtual and handled inmemory in the elevate web builder client application using a disconnected database architecture. Database management systems dbmss are a ubiquitous and critical component of modern computing, and the result of decades of research and development in both academia and industry. Design your own database concept to implementation or how to design a database without touching a computer the following is an aggregation of several online resources with a bit of personal insight and experience thrown in for good measure. A database architect is an individual who is responsible for creating and managing the data aspects within a database architecture. Threeschema architecture and data independence database languages and interfaces the database system environment dbms architectures classification of database management systems 2. Apply to 1016 database architect jobs in india on, indias no.
Dbms architectures in a and b, the disk is the primary storage for the database and data is brought into main memory as it is needed. There are numerous high availability features that you can use in the oracle database singleinstance database architecture. The oracle sga is the most important memory structure in oracle. Three database architectures for a multitenant rails. Database administrators stack exchange is a question and answer site for database professionals who wish to improve their database skills and learn from others in the community. To access the data stored in the database and to update the database, you use a. Explore the job duties of a database architect, as well as the education requirements and salary for the position. Database design involves constructing a suitable model of this information. N tiermultitier, 3tier, 2tier architecture with example. The database management system dbms acts as an interface between the database and the user programs. This architecture model provides software developers to create reusable applicationsystems with maximum flexibility. The first option is to use a separate database for each tenant. The architecture of a database system is very much influenced by the primary computer system on which the database system runs. The database architect is the highlyskilled expert that creates and maintains.
Datastax strongly recommends taking time to read these topics. An architecture and data model for cad databases alejandro p. High availability architectures and solutions 11g release 2. Database design the requirements gathering and specification provides you with a highlevel understanding of the organization, its data, and the processes that you must model in the database. Jan 26, 2017 data architecture is a set of rules, policies, standards and models that govern and define the type of data collected and how it is used, stored, managed and integrated within an organization and its database systems. Afterwards, the generic database architecture is explained. Database architecture and basic concepts slideshare. Design database applications, such as interfaces, data transfer mechanisms, global temporary tables, data partitions, and functionbased indexes to enable efficient access of the generic database structure. Salary estimates are based on 1,800 salaries submitted anonymously to glassdoor. Architecture free download as powerpoint presentation. Lecture outline data models threeschema architecture and data independence database languages and interfaces the database system environment dbms architectures classification of database management systems 2. They can either directly connect to the database or their request is received by intermediary layer, which synthesizes the request and then it sends to database. Mar 21, 2020 a database architect is an individual who is responsible for creating and managing the data aspects within a database architecture.
It is the most widely used architecture to design a dbms. A database is a persistent, logically coherent collection of inherently meaningful data, relevant to some aspects of the real world. This paper presents socrates, a new architecture for oltp database systems born out of microsofts experience of man aging millions of databases in azure. Explore database architect job openings in india now. At this tier, the database resides along with its query processing languages. There are different types of ntier architectures, like 3tier architecture, 2tier architecture and 1 tier architecture. Data model collection of concepts that describe the structure of a database provides means to achieve data abstraction suppression of details of data organization and storage highlighting of the essential features for an improved understanding of data includes basic operations retrievals and updates on the database. Open problems concern parallel system architectures, operat ing system support, data placement, parallel database programming languages, parallel algorithms. A database management system can be centralised all the data stored at one location, decentralised multiple copies of database at different locations or hierarchical, depending upon its architecture. The old models of data architecture arent enough for todays datadriven business demands. Oracle database is a singleinstance, standalone noncluster database and it is the foundation for all high availability architectures. Essential information for understanding and using datastax enterprise internode communications gossip.
All database requestsresponses use the json format for any associated data. A database is an object for storing complex, structured information. This architecture is based on the three schema architecture for data base management system and three. What is the difference between database architecture and.
1249 1427 1079 1499 810 1417 1304 1346 1063 554 387 326 1169 1270 258 479 1223 243 1386 513 902 749 1488 702 1627 968 1112 206 580 590 385 1023 403 52 16 1247 138 1106 906